Class Of 2027 Five-Star Offensive Tackle Layton Von Brandt Decommits From Penn State Football

When it rains, it pours.

Class of 2027 five-star offensive tackle Layton Von Brandt has decommitted from Penn State football, he announced on Sunday afternoon following James Franklin’s firing. He joins four-star wideout Khalil Taylor and four-star defensive back Gabriel Jenkins as 2027 recruits to decommit from Penn State in the past three days.

Von Brandt committed to the Nittany Lions in November 2024 as Penn State’s second pledge of the 2027 recruiting class. He is tabbed as the No. 1 player in Delaware, No. 5 offensive tackle in the class of 2027, and the No. 36 player in the nation.

Five-star running back Kemon Spell is the sole commit left for Penn State in the class. He stated that he isn’t “100% with Penn State” on Friday.

Von Brandt currently has offers from Big Ten programs Ohio State, Rutgers, and Indiana. Other notable programs include Georgia, Tennessee, Florida, Florida State, and Syracuse.
